You can get from desk to dock in 10 minutes West Parry Sound Health Centre (WPSHC) has always employed an innovative planning approach aimed at integrating services. Faced with the challenges of rural care delivery, WPSHC has partnered in regional alliances and created internal programming solutions that have benefited patient care and improved services throughout the catchment area. Today our uniquely integrated health care organization includes: Lakeland Long Term Care, six Nursing Stations delivering care to rural communities, management of District ambulance services and dispatch, and a full range of in-patient and out-patient programs associated with a 90-bed acute care hospital. As well as being recognized as a "pace-setter" hospital for its unbroken string of balanced budgets, WPSHC's innovative approach to integration has benefited the community through more seamless local delivery of services, improved access to primary care, a wider understanding of local needs and the ability to respond as these needs continue to evolve. Additionally, these initiatives have resulted in cost savings through co-location and improved 'point-of-service' for clients. The Personal Support Worker (PSW) assists and supports the Nursing Department and members of the multi-disciplinary team. The PSW provides support in activities of daily living for patients for whom the outcomes are predictable and assists nursing staff in the transfer and positioning of patients with more complex needs. The PSW provides patient care within the policies and procedures of the Health Centre under the supervision of the Registered Nurse and Registered Practical Nurse.
